Once after making a fruit cake, I had some fruit and nuts left over. I mixed them into a basic cookie dough along with pineapple and coconut. These soft, colorful cookies are a nice addition to a Christmas dessert tray.

Nutritional Facts 1 serving (2 each) equals 165 calories, 8 g fat (3 g saturated fat), 19 mg cholesterol, 92 mg sodium, 21 g carbohydrate, 1 g fiber, 2 g protein.
